JAMMU, Apr 11: Engineers appointed under the Prime Minister’s Package (PM Package) in the Public Works Department (R&B) in 2010 have accused the department of sidelining their batch in the recent promotions to Assistant Executive Engineer (AEE), terming it a “grave injustice” and “discriminatory order’’.
In a statement issued here, today the package engineers said the controversy stems from Government Order (G.O.) No. 120 PW(R&B) of 2026, issued on April 10, 2026, which granted promotions to Batch 2011 from Assistant Engineer (Civil) to AEE, allegedly bypassing the 2010 PM Package batch.
They said these engineers were initially incorporated into the final seniority list of R&B engineers vide G.O. No. 460 of 2019. However, G.O. No. 34 JK DMRRR of 2022 led to a separate seniority list under G.O. No. 277 PW(R&B) of 2022. They were promoted as Assistant Engineers on supernumerary posts vide G.O. No. 211 PW(R&B) of 2022.
They said a meeting chaired by Chief Secretary Atal Dulloo last year has issued the Minutes of Meeting (MOM ) directed that their issues should be examined and status report should be prepared vide MOM No. DMRRR-MR/35-2025 dated December 9, 2025.
Subsequently, PWD(R&B) constituted an Internal Committee on February 4, this year to define functional roles across zonal, divisional, and sub-divisional levels, examine transitions from supernumerary to substantive posts for equitable career progression and submit a detailed report within two months (by April 4, 2026).
Despite the deadline, no report has been filed, fueling accusations of deliberate delay, they said.
“This is a clear violation of due process and repeated Government directives,” a PM Package engineer said on condition of anonymity.
The engineers have demanded immediate rectification, urging absorption and inclusion in promotions to uphold fairness for these “hapless engineers.”
Meanwhile BJP Displaced District president Rajoo Kumar Pandita, party spokesperson and ex MLC , Ajay Bharti, BJP KDD Prabhari, Chand Ji Bhat and co convener, H L Bhat have expressed their grave concern over what they called denial of promotions to package employees. In a joint statement they said this shows the mindset of present NC Government which has always treated the community as second class citizens. They warned to launch agitation in case the justice is not given to hapless employees of the community who at the risk of their lives volunteered to serve in Valley.
R K Bhat president Youth All India Kashmiri Samaj (YAIKS) who has been pursuing the issue of displaced youth and whose organisation struggled for the package has also expressed his concern over the denial of promotions to package engineers and urged the Government to settle the issue without further delay.
However, when contacted the Additional Secretary, PWD Tanveer Majid Wani said that the package employees have been appointed on supernumerary posts so their promotion orders will be issued separately within some days.
